AMBA Taipei Ximending
Well, the name says for itself where this hotel is located. We were right in the heart of XMD with a small Eslite mall just below the hotel (i gathered there are several in XMD itself). We booked the Medium room and was upgraded to a Large room WHEE! just for us though, not for my parents...we arrived a day earlier btw.
It's a very new and modern hotel. The lobby is on the 5th floor (i think) and it is beautifully decorated. Receptionists were really friendly and helpful too. Pricing wise was a little on the high side i believe. We paid 130 per night but we really liked the place so no complains!
PLUS points:
- Free yellow slippers :P
- Young and fun atmosphere
- Therapeutic ginger flavoured shampoo and showerfoam that were replenished daily
- Comfortable bed, good range of tv channels
- In the middle of XMD
- Good breakfast selection and the bar, buffet area is REALLY artsy and amazing
